Abstract

Out of five ethnic groups residing in the border area of Ky Son district, Nghe An province, the Hmong and Khmu account for a larger proportion of the total population than the rest. They also have relationship with people of the same or different ethnic groups in other countries with and without a border with Vietnam. In particular, unique features in terms of their marriage, family and lineage relationships, as well as ethnic relationships, which are increasingly strengthened, expressed through means of earning a living, social activities, cultural exchanges, etc., have been bringing significant income to local households, transforming the economic structure, and contributing to the preservation of ethnic cultures.
